Visão Geral
Curso Solidity Smart Contract Engineer. Torne-se um especialista em escrever contratos inteligentes, crie projetos, aprenda tópicos avançados como capacidade de atualização, segurança, otimização de gás e roll-ups Zk. Curso Solidity Smart Contract Engineer, inclui aprender a escrever contratos inteligentes, tópicos avançados e construir vários projetos, Ao final do Curso Solidity Smart Contract Engineer, lance sua própria startup ou seja desenvolvedor no setor
Objetivo
Após realizar este Curso Solidity Smart Contract Engineer você será capaz de:
- Aprender Solidity e como construir dApps pode ser assustador. Há muito conteúdo por aí, mas nenhuma abordagem estruturada para aprender Solidity from Zero to Hero.
- Neste programa, estamos criando uma abordagem estruturada para ajudá-lo a aprender os fundamentos da Web 3.0, Solidity, escrever contratos inteligentes, construir dApps e ajudá-lo a construir vários projetos para prepará-lo para a indústria.
- Neste curso, você obterá experiência prática sobre como arquitetar, construir e dimensionar um aplicativo Web 3.0 no Ethereum, além de construir um aplicativo protegido contra hackers.
- Ao final do curso, você terá pelo menos 4 projetos em seu GitHub junto com um aplicativo pronto para produção que poderá apresentar em seu portfólio.
- Acima de tudo, você fará conexões valiosas e amizades duradouras com desenvolvedores da Web 3.0, crentes e potenciais cofundadores.
- Você terá as habilidades necessárias para ser colocado no setor ou lançar sua própria startup.
Publico Alvo
- Desenvolvedores
- Alunos
- Fundadores
- Qualquer pessoa que queira desenvolver dApps no Ethereum
Pre-Requisitos
- Não são necessários pré-requisitos. A linguagem de programação anterior é útil
- Lançaremos duas sessões para que as pessoas possam se atualizar sobre Java Script antes da sessão. Então, não se preocupe!
Materiais
Inglês + Exercícios + Lab Pratico
Conteúdo Programatico
Introduction to Web 3.0, Blockchain
- Introduction to Solidity
- Solidity Programming
Solidity
- Ethereum Architecture
- Variables,
- Inheritance,
- Implicit conversion,
- Explicit Conversion,
- Cryptography,
- Call back
Functions
- Constructor
- Receive Function
- Fallback Function
- External
- Public
- Internal
- Private
- View and Pure
Projects
- Building ERC 20 (Fungible Token Standard)
- ERC 721
- ERC 721A
- ERC 1155
- AMM (UniSwap V2)
- Lending (Collateralized Lending)
- Vaults (Decentralized Crypto Safe Storing)
- Staking (Depositing Tokens into Contract for Yield)
- Flash Loans (Borrow Crypto without Collateral)
- Other projects
Advanced Solidity
- Delegate Calls
- Factory Smart Contracts
- Smart contract Upgradeability etc
- Gas Optimization
Security and Scaling Solutions
- Basics of Smart Contract Security
- Basics of Zk Rollups
- High-level features of ZkSync 2.0
- Basics of Polygon ZkEvm
Collaborate
- Architect and build a Web 3.0 app from scratch with a team of developers
TENHO INTERESSE